red meat: increases risk for diabetes, role of TMAO

  A recent analysis of the Nurses’ Health Studies and Health Professionals' Follow-up Study revealed a relationship between consuming red meat and the development of diabetes in men and women (see   dm red meat AmJClinNut2023  in dropbox or  https://doi.org/10.1016/j.ajcnut.2023.08.021   ) Details : -- 216,695 participants from the combination of the Nurses’ Health Study, Nurses’ Health Study II, and Health Professionals Follow-up Study, all having relied on detailed assessments of their dietary intake, with food frequency questionnaires every 2 to 4 years that semiquantitatively comprised 61 food items initially, which increased in 1984 to 120 items      -- the studies were started in 1976-1989, with follow-up until at least 2016      -- 5,483,981 person-years of follow-up were evaluated for intakes of total, processed (eg, hotdogs, bacon), and unprocessed red meat -- mean age at baseline 36-53yo (all of these baseline va...

antibiotic-resistant microorganisms can spread within the community

  A recent study found that antibiotic -resistant microbes  can  spread  to the broader community not exposed to antibiotics (see  microbiome population effect of antibiotics NatCommunic2023  in dropbox, or  doi.org/10.1038/s41467-023-36633-7 )    Details :  -- 8972 human microbiome samples were analyzed, the vast majority from the gut microbiome (7589  of them) , analyzing  the amino acid spans of DNA that help with predicting actual gene function (for those in the know,  the open reading frames or ORFs)     -- the study focused on 3096 gut microbiomes from healthy individuals not taking antibiotics, assessing  them for  many of the  known  antimicrobial resistance genes (ARGs)          --  healthy individuals  were defined as  those with out  C difficile infections, cholera, colorectal adenomas  and  cancer, inflammat...
